如何将Window B中的文本框值绑定到Window A中滑块的值?我希望这是双向绑定,以便手动更改文本框值在滑块拇指位置反映自身。表单中的元素绑定非常简单,但Windows之间的绑定对我来说是一个谜。
答案 0 :(得分:1)
我将创建一个包含您希望绑定到的值的公共属性的类。
创建对象的实例,并将DataContext
B中TextBox
的{{1}}属性设置为该对象。将Window
A中DataContext
的{{1}}属性设置为同一对象。将FrameworkElements的Slider
对象的Path属性设置为您创建的公共属性的名称。实施Window
并在您的setter中触发PropertyChanged事件。